Public Awareness: The Benefits of Choosing Eco-Friendly Building Materials
Introduction to Eco-Friendly Building Materials
Modern construction demands materials that balance structural integrity, cost efficiency, and environmental responsibility. Eco-friendly building materials—such as FlyAsh Blocks, bamboo, recycled steel, and hempcrete—reduce carbon footprints while maintaining performance. In India, sustainable construction aligns with green building standards and stricter environmental regulations.
Why Choose Eco-Friendly Building Materials?
Switching to sustainable materials addresses three core priorities:
- Resource conservation: Reduced reliance on finite natural resources like clay or sand.
- Energy efficiency: Lower embodied energy compared to conventional materials.
- Regulatory alignment: Compliance with India’s Energy Conservation Building Code (ECBC) and green certification systems (GRIHA, IGBC).
Environmental Benefits
Eco-friendly materials actively mitigate construction’s ecological impact:
- FlyAsh Blocks utilise industrial by-products (fly ash), diverting waste from landfills.
- Bamboo sequesters carbon and regenerates rapidly without fertilisers.
- Recycled steel reduces mining demand by repurposing scrap metal.
FlyAsh Blocks alone reduce CO2 emissions by ~30% compared to traditional clay bricks (IS 2185-3 guidelines).
Health and Safety Advantages
Non-toxic materials improve indoor air quality and worker safety:
- FlyAsh Blocks emit no volatile organic compounds (VOCs).
- Hempcrete resists mould and regulates humidity naturally.
- Recycled steel eliminates hazardous coatings found in some industrial metals.
Cost-Effectiveness in the Long Run
While initial costs may be marginally higher, lifecycle savings emerge through:
- Durability: FlyAsh Blocks resist weathering better than red bricks, reducing maintenance (IS 3495).
- Energy savings: Thermal-efficient materials like hempcrete slash HVAC costs.
- Waste reduction: Precisely sized materials (e.g., thin-bed adhesives for FlyAsh Blocks) minimise on-site wastage.
Popular Eco-Friendly Building Materials
Bamboo: A Sustainable Alternative
With a tensile strength surpassing steel (IS 15912), bamboo suits temporary structures and interior applications. However, untreated bamboo requires protective coatings in humid climates.
Recycled Steel: Durable and Green
Steel retains 100% recyclability without quality loss. Ideal for structural frames, it reduces raw material consumption by 75% compared to virgin ore processing.
Hempcrete: The Future of Insulation
A blend of hemp husk and lime, hempcrete offers superior thermal insulation (0.06–0.13 W/m·K) and carbon negativity. It’s compatible with FlyAsh Block walls for enhanced energy efficiency.
How to Transition to Eco-Friendly Materials
Adopting sustainable materials requires strategic planning:
- Conduct lifecycle assessments (LCA) to compare material impacts.
- Prioritise locally available options (e.g., FlyAsh Blocks near thermal plants).
- Train masons in specialised techniques (e.g., thin-bed mortar application).
Challenges and Solutions
Barriers like higher upfront costs or limited awareness can be overcome by:
- Leveraging government subsidies for green materials under PMAY-U or state schemes.
- Partnering with certified suppliers adhering to IS codes.
